Leaky Dishwashing machine


This is possibly one of the most everyday dishwashing machine trouble, and also the good news is that it is simple to recognize. Leakages occur because of a number of factors, and also the leaks can bungle your kitchen area. Usual causes of dishwasher leaks include;
  • Incorrect pipeline link: If the pipelines at the back of your device are not safely fixed or if they are worn, it can cause leaks.

  • Inappropriate dish stacking: Constantly ensure that you do not overstack the tray which you prepare the recipes correctly

  • Way too much detergent: Putting sufficient cleaning agent could likewise create a leak. Guarantee that you place just enough for your meals and also not more.

  • Rust: It can additionally be a result of some rust or deterioration of your machine. In this case, it is much better to change the dishwasher.

  • Door Seals: Check if the door seals are still intact as well as firmly attached. If the seals are not in position, it could be a considerable source of leakages.

  • Bad-Smelling Dishwasher


    This is another typical dishwashing machine trouble, and also it is mainly triggered by food debris or oil sticking around in the machine. In this case, search for these bits, take them out as well as do the dishes without any meals inside the device. Laundry the filter extensively. That will certainly assist remove the negative scent. Ensure that you remove every food particle from your dishes before transferring it to the machine in the future.

    Inability to Drain


    In some cases you may discover a big quantity of water left in your bathtub after a clean. That is most likely a drainage trouble. You can either inspect the drain pipe for damages or clogs. When unsure, contact a specialist to have it inspected and taken care of.

    Does not clean effectively


    If your meals as well as cutleries appear of the dish washer as well as still look dirty or dirty, your spray arms may be a problem. In a lot of cases, the spray arms can get obstructed, as well as it will call for a quick clean or a substitute to work properly once again.

    My Dishes Are Still Dirty


    This is at the top of a list for a reason. Dirty dishes are common and frustrating. Easy fixes first; check if your dishwasher has a manual filter and make sure that it’s clean and clear of debris. Then, as you load your dishwasher, make sure that the spray arms can rotate freely, spraying water throughout the drum. If they’re blocked or obstructed, you won’t be getting optimal cleaning performance. If the problem continues, check if your spray arms are clean and moving freely as grease and food particles can prevent them from spinning.



    Also, stop pre-rinsing your dishes! Modern dishwashers use sensors to determine the soil level of the dishes. If you rinse them off too much, your dishwasher may select a shorter cycle than is necessary. Modern detergents also use enzymes that activate when they come in contact with food particles. If you remove the particles, your detergent will be less effective too.


    My Dishes Aren’t Drying


    The easiest fixes here are to add Rinse Aid to your dishwasher when you start the load to assist drying, and to make sure you don’t stack plastic against plastic or other hard to dry materials. It’s also a good idea to open the dishwasher door when the cycle is complete to release steam and prevent condensation from settling on your dishes (some higher-end machines even open automatically). If your dishwasher has a heating element, you may have to check if it is working properly. Check also the fan if your dishwasher has a stainless steel tub that uses blown radiant heat to dry.


    My Dishwasher Smells Bad


    If your dishwasher smells bad, make sure your filter and screens are cleaned of any grime and food residue. Check the spray arms and gasket on the door to make sure there’s no grease or food waste there as well. If you’ve done that, then it may just be time to sanitize the drum. Place a small bowl with vinegar in the upper basket of your empty dishwasher and run the sanitize cycle (or the hottest cycle you’ve got) to blast away bad odours.


    My Dishwasher Won’t Start


    If your dishwasher won’t start there’s often an electrical problem, and if you’re lucky that means there’s a very easy fix. Ask yourself, have I tried turning it off and on? If not, then do that. If it’s still not working, try unplugging and re-plugging in the machine and double-check your breaker to make sure power is feeding the unit. If it’s a mechanical problem, then it may be that your door isn’t latching properly and a simple realignment will get things sorted out.


    My Dishwasher Won’t Fill


    If possible, check your intake valves and make sure that the screen is clear and that there’s no blockage obstructing water flow. If that’s not it, then the float and/or float switch located at the bottom of the drum could be the problem. Make sure that the electrical connections are intact and that the mechanism hasn’t been damaged or blocked in any way.
